Wizards' Bradley Beal coming off bench, Garrett Temple to start
Washington Wizards shooting guard Bradley Beal is coming off bench on Saturday against the Charlotte Hornets. Garrett Temple will get the start in his place.
What It Means:
Beal got the start last night, but Temple, who ranks 94th in the league with a -2.2 nERD will be back with the starters tonight. Temple is averaging 8.5 points, 2.6 rebounds and 1.9 assists in 25.7 minutes per game this season.
